    Extreme Networks has an immediate need for a seasoned Trade Compliance Manager.

    Our need in this discipline is a direct result of growth in our business and the associated transformation of our global Supply Chain operations.

    This newly created position within the Global Trade Compliance team will primarily focus on special projects and initiatives supporting the Supply Chain and its efforts to improve the overall business processes.

    Included in this will be our new initiative to implement an effective a Duty Drawback program with our Duty Drawback Provider.

    This initiative includes with our Accounting, IT, Supply Chain and Trade Compliance organizations to implement this new process.

    An understanding and ability to link critical business data, business process, import/export data within our systems and our 3PL providers will critical for the initiative.

    Further considerations are the on-going challenges associated with our Global Trade Compliance processes and the constant fine tuning needed as new products are released and or the regulatory environment changes.

    Understanding aspects such as effective HTS code classification and other product categories during our new product introductions will be a key effort in this approach.

    This newly created position will report to the Sr.

    Manager of Global Trade Compliance and will be responsible for helping to design and implement Trade Compliance processes as a senior member of this team.

    Ensuring compliance with the newly created US Tariff regulations and an effective Drawback Program in the constant changing regulatory landscape of duty outlay and drawback is a critical aspect of this position.

    Extreme Networks operates in a high volume fully integrated 3PL environment so leveraging our technology and systems integration with our Duty Drawback provider will be key for success.

    Extreme Networks is expected to payout over $42m USD annually in duty with an expected drawback of approximately $25m USD based on our Export sales.

    So this is a vital and important balance sheet and cash flow aspect of the company's accounting and finances.

    This visible position is expected to understand and anticipate the requirements of a global inbound US supply chain along with the challenges of our diverse global customer base.

    Ability to analyze needs and conditions within the businesses of Extreme Networks as it relates to Trade Compliance.

    This position is responsible for identifying, implementing and maintaining operational efficiencies with a particular emphasis on Compliance within our Trade Control business processes, centralized brokerage and duty drawback effectiveness.

    Creating the ability for Extreme Networks to be agile and cost competitive in this effort is an important success factor.
